The Highland Games


This weekend we got down to business and checked off the first item on our summer budget bucket list. I threw a bunch of crap in the car {because a toddler always needs a bunch of stuff for a road trip} and off we went! Saturday was the most perfect of days. The sun was shining, a light breeze was blowing and we were going to our very first Highland Games.

Let it be known now that I have never seen such brute strength in all my life. Or so many kilts in one place...

The games were in a giant field and we couldn't really get too close. Which was a bummer because I wanted to get up close and personal with these brawny men. It was all in the name of safety though. They were throwing tree's and boulders you know. I just looked on in awe. These guys were the real deal. I preferred the Highland Dancing and the Bagpipe competition. I loved the costumes and the music. It just felt Scottish.

Once we'd walked around the whole field I was starving. I don't do well when I'm hungry. So we set off to find the food trucks. There was only one. Seriously. The Luss Highland Gathering hadn't been on for the past 2 yrs due to flooding so there was a massive amount of people there. Everyone was selling out of food and there was one lone truck left. We waited in the queue for 45 minutes. I kid you not. But, the burgers were worth it. Scottish beef with haggis and whiskey chutney on a homemade floury roll. Oh. Em. Gee. I dreamt about it that night. I want more.

You guys, it was such an experience. Loads of people rooting for their favourite hunky guys and Scottish gourmet food. What more do you want?!
